Проверка сертификата с помощью KalkanCryptCOM
(0 чел.) 
  • Страница:
  • 1

ТЕМА: Проверка сертификата с помощью KalkanCryptCOM

Проверка сертификата с помощью KalkanCryptCOM 2 года, 2 мес. назад #3165

  • knfissenko
  • Новый участник
  • Постов: 9
  • Репутация: 0
Мне необходимо проверить сертификат с учетом времени, то есть был ли он валиден на момент подписания.

В примере SDK проверка сертификата осуществляется через следующий код:
KalkanCOMTest.X509ValidateCertificate(inCert, validType, validPath, 0, out outInfo);

4-й параметр - это long checkTime. Непонятно как его использовать.

Re: Проверка сертификата с помощью KalkanCryptCOM 2 года, 2 мес. назад #3195

  • Murat Seisenov
  • Модератор
  • Постов: 391
  • Репутация: 19
Добрый день!

Данный параметр пока не используется, зарезервирован на будущее.
Пока решение только одно: Вам необходимо сохранять вместе с подписью CRL на момент подписания.
Модератор

Re: Проверка сертификата с помощью KalkanCryptCOM 2 года, 2 мес. назад #3203

  • knfissenko
  • Новый участник
  • Постов: 9
  • Репутация: 0
Подпись я получаю вместе с обращением гражданина с портала электронного правительства. Сам я не формирую, мне нужно только проверить. Ну буду проверять на текущий момент.

Re: Проверка сертификата с помощью KalkanCryptCOM 2 года, 2 мес. назад #3206

  • knfissenko
  • Новый участник
  • Постов: 9
  • Репутация: 0
Тогда другой вопрос возникает: если срок сертификата истек к тому моменту, когда я его проверяю (а на момент подписания был действующим), функция X509ValidateCertificate вернет мне, что он не валиден?
  • Страница:
  • 1
FaLang translation system by Faboba